What is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ll?
A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. The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ll file specifically is a component of the Autodesk Quantity Takeoff 2013 software. This DLL file contains important functions and data that the Quantity Takeoff program needs to run properly.
It helps the software perform tasks like taking off measurements from digital designs and estimating materials for construction projects. Common Issues and Errors Related to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ll
D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.
-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ll not found: The required DLL file is absent from the expected directory. This can result from software uninstalls, updates, or system changes that mistakenly remove or relocate DLL files.
-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ll Access Violation: This message indicates that a program has tried to access memory that it shouldn't. It could be caused by software bugs, outdated drivers, or conflicts between software.
- Cannot register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
- This application failed to start because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This message suggests that the application is trying to run a DLL file that it can't locate, which may be due to deletion or displacement of the DLL file. Reinstallation could potentially restore the necessary DLL file to its correct location.
-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ll could not be loaded: This error suggests that the system was unable to load the DLL file into memory. This could happen due to file corruption, incompatibility, or because the file is missing or incorrectly installed.

Perform a Repair Install of Windows
![Perform a Repair Install of Windows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/repair-install.jpg)
How to perform a repair install of Windows to repair Autodesk.Takeoff.DataModel.dll issues.
![Step 1: Create a Windows 10 Installation Media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/installation-media.jpg)
-
Go to the Microsoft website and download the Windows 10 Media Creation Tool.
-
Run the tool and select Create installation media for another PC.
-
Follow the prompts to create a bootable USB drive or ISO file.
![Step 2: Start the Repair Install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/repair-install.jpg)
-
Insert the Windows 10 installation media you created into your PC and run setup.exe.
-
Follow the prompts until you get to the Ready to install screen.
![Step 3: Choose the Right Install Option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/install-option.jpg)
-
On the Ready to install screen, make sure Keep personal files and apps is selected.
-
Click Install to start the repair install.
![Step 4: Complete the Installation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/installation-complete.jpg)
-
Your computer will restart several times during the installation. Make sure not to turn off your computer during this process.
Update Your Device Drivers
![Update Your Device Drivers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/update-driver.jpg)
In this guide, we outline the steps necessary to update the device drivers on your system.
![Step 1: Open Device Manager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/device-manager.jpg)
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Device Manager
in the search bar and press Enter.
![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/identify-driver.jpg)
-
In the Device Manager window, locate the device whose driver you want to update.
-
Click on the arrow or plus sign next to the device category to expand it.
-
Right-click on the device and select Update driver.
![Step 3: Update the Driver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/update-driver.jpg)
-
In the next window, select Search automatically for updated driver software.
-
Follow the prompts to install the driver update.
